Download free for 30 days
Sign in
Upload
Language (EN)
Support
Business
Mobile
Social Media
Marketing
Technology
Art & Photos
Career
Design
Education
Presentations & Public Speaking
Government & Nonprofit
Healthcare
Internet
Law
Leadership & Management
Automotive
Engineering
Software
Recruiting & HR
Retail
Sales
Services
Science
Small Business & Entrepreneurship
Food
Environment
Economy & Finance
Data & Analytics
Investor Relations
Sports
Spiritual
News & Politics
Travel
Self Improvement
Real Estate
Entertainment & Humor
Health & Medicine
Devices & Hardware
Lifestyle
Change Language
Language
English
Español
Português
Français
Deutsche
Cancel
Save
Submit search
EN
Uploaded by
uchan_nos
PPTX, PDF
831 views
Security Nextcamp remote mob programming
How to mob-program remotely
Engineering
◦
Read more
0
Save
Share
Embed
Embed presentation
Download
Download to read offline
1
/ 10
2
/ 10
3
/ 10
4
/ 10
5
/ 10
6
/ 10
7
/ 10
8
/ 10
9
/ 10
10
/ 10
More Related Content
PDF
Nkcug プレゼン01
by
Masashi Maruya
PDF
[120915] igda sig indie9
by
IGDA Japan
PPTX
Blue monkey architecture overview
by
Atsushi Nakamura
PDF
シン モブ・プログラミング 第三形態
by
atsushi nagata
PPTX
Mob Programming ってなんですか?
by
Toshiyuki Ando
PPTX
MobProgramming at クリエーションライン
by
Toshiyuki Ando
PPTX
MobProgrammingを体験してみよう!
by
Toshiyuki Ando
PPTX
モブプログラミングを体験しよう at Agile Japan 2017 愛媛サテライト
by
Toshiyuki Ando
Nkcug プレゼン01
by
Masashi Maruya
[120915] igda sig indie9
by
IGDA Japan
Blue monkey architecture overview
by
Atsushi Nakamura
シン モブ・プログラミング 第三形態
by
atsushi nagata
Mob Programming ってなんですか?
by
Toshiyuki Ando
MobProgramming at クリエーションライン
by
Toshiyuki Ando
MobProgrammingを体験してみよう!
by
Toshiyuki Ando
モブプログラミングを体験しよう at Agile Japan 2017 愛媛サテライト
by
Toshiyuki Ando
More from uchan_nos
PPTX
MikanOSと自作CPUをUSBで接続する
by
uchan_nos
PPTX
OSを手作りするという趣味と仕事
by
uchan_nos
PPTX
小型安価なFPGAボードの紹介と任意波形発生器
by
uchan_nos
PPTX
トランジスタ回路:エミッタ接地増幅回路
by
uchan_nos
PPTX
OpeLa: セルフホストなOSと言語処理系を作るプロジェクト
by
uchan_nos
PPTX
自作言語でお絵描き
by
uchan_nos
PPTX
OpeLa 進捗報告 at 第23回自作OSもくもく会
by
uchan_nos
PPTX
サイボウズ・ラボへ転籍して1年を振り返る
by
uchan_nos
PPTX
USB3.0ドライバ開発の道
by
uchan_nos
PPTX
Langsmith OpeLa handmade self-hosted OS and LPS
by
uchan_nos
PPTX
OpeLa セルフホストなOSと言語処理系の自作
by
uchan_nos
PPTX
自動でバグを見つける!プログラム解析と動的バイナリ計装
by
uchan_nos
PDF
1を書いても0が読める!?隠れた重要命令INVLPG
by
uchan_nos
PDF
レガシーフリーOSに必要な要素技術 legacy free os
by
uchan_nos
PDF
Building libc++ for toy OS
by
uchan_nos
PDF
プランクトンサミットの歴史2019
by
uchan_nos
PDF
Introduction of security camp 2019
by
uchan_nos
PDF
30分で分かる!OSの作り方 ver.2
by
uchan_nos
PDF
Timers
by
uchan_nos
PDF
USB3 host driver program structure
by
uchan_nos
MikanOSと自作CPUをUSBで接続する
by
uchan_nos
OSを手作りするという趣味と仕事
by
uchan_nos
小型安価なFPGAボードの紹介と任意波形発生器
by
uchan_nos
トランジスタ回路:エミッタ接地増幅回路
by
uchan_nos
OpeLa: セルフホストなOSと言語処理系を作るプロジェクト
by
uchan_nos
自作言語でお絵描き
by
uchan_nos
OpeLa 進捗報告 at 第23回自作OSもくもく会
by
uchan_nos
サイボウズ・ラボへ転籍して1年を振り返る
by
uchan_nos
USB3.0ドライバ開発の道
by
uchan_nos
Langsmith OpeLa handmade self-hosted OS and LPS
by
uchan_nos
OpeLa セルフホストなOSと言語処理系の自作
by
uchan_nos
自動でバグを見つける!プログラム解析と動的バイナリ計装
by
uchan_nos
1を書いても0が読める!?隠れた重要命令INVLPG
by
uchan_nos
レガシーフリーOSに必要な要素技術 legacy free os
by
uchan_nos
Building libc++ for toy OS
by
uchan_nos
プランクトンサミットの歴史2019
by
uchan_nos
Introduction of security camp 2019
by
uchan_nos
30分で分かる!OSの作り方 ver.2
by
uchan_nos
Timers
by
uchan_nos
USB3 host driver program structure
by
uchan_nos
Recently uploaded
PPTX
君をむしばむこの力で_最終発表-1-Monthon2025最終発表用資料-.pptx
by
rintakano624
PDF
2025/12/12 AutoDevNinjaピッチ資料 - 大人な男のAuto Dev環境
by
Masahiro Takechi
PDF
ソフトウェアエンジニアがクルマのコアを創る!? モビリティの価値を最大化するソフトウェア開発の最前線【DENSO Tech Night 第一夜】
by
dots.
PDF
krsk_aws_re-growth_aws_devops_agent_20251211
by
uedayuki
PDF
ソフトとハードの二刀流で実現する先進安全・自動運転のアルゴリズム開発【DENSO Tech Night 第二夜】 ー高精度な画像解析 / AI推論モデル ...
by
dots.
PDF
音楽アーティスト探索体験に特化した音楽ディスカバリーWebサービス「DigLoop」|Created byヨハク技研
by
yohakugiken
君をむしばむこの力で_最終発表-1-Monthon2025最終発表用資料-.pptx
by
rintakano624
2025/12/12 AutoDevNinjaピッチ資料 - 大人な男のAuto Dev環境
by
Masahiro Takechi
ソフトウェアエンジニアがクルマのコアを創る!? モビリティの価値を最大化するソフトウェア開発の最前線【DENSO Tech Night 第一夜】
by
dots.
krsk_aws_re-growth_aws_devops_agent_20251211
by
uedayuki
ソフトとハードの二刀流で実現する先進安全・自動運転のアルゴリズム開発【DENSO Tech Night 第二夜】 ー高精度な画像解析 / AI推論モデル ...
by
dots.
音楽アーティスト探索体験に特化した音楽ディスカバリーWebサービス「DigLoop」|Created byヨハク技研
by
yohakugiken
Security Nextcamp remote mob programming
1.
自作Cコンパイラはモブプロで最適化の夢を見るか? モブプログラミング セキュリティ・ネクストキャンプ2020 2020年10月24日 uchan
3.
モブプログラミングとは • 略してモブプロ • 3人以上が集まって •
同じ時間に • 同じ画面を見て • 同じ課題に一緒に取り組む • Hunter Industryでのモブプロの様子 • https://www.youtube.com/watch?v=dVqUcNKVbYg • Hunter Industryはモブプロの聖地
4.
色々なモブプロ • メンバーのレベルがある程度そろっているモブプロ • がんがん実装を進めていく •
互いに学びもある • このスライドの想定はこれ • ベテランと新人のモブプロ • ベテランが新人に教えつつ開発を進める • ベテランは教え方が上手くなり,新人は大量に知識を吸収
5.
ドライバーとナビゲーター • ドライバー • ナビゲーターの議論の結果をコードで表現する •
自分の考えだけでコーディングを進めない • ナビゲーター • 何を実装するかを議論する • ドライバーが理解できる最も高い抽象度の表現で伝える • チームの文化によって役割の差はある ドライバー https://gds.blog.gov.uk/2016/09/01/using -mob-programming-to-solve-a-problem/
6.
モブプロの良さ • 互いに分からないことを補完しあえる • 調べる時間が短縮される •
不正確な知識を得てしまう可能性が下がる • チームメンバー皆が内部構造等に詳しくなる • ドキュメント量を削減できる • チームメンバーの知識レベルを揃えられる • 属人性をある程度防げる • チームでわいわい楽しい!
7.
リモート・モブプログラミング サイボウズ株式会社の事例 様々な場所からリモートで モブプロを行っている https://blog.cybozu.io/entry/2020/02/28/080000
8.
リモート・モブプロのやり方 • ドライバーの順序を決める • ドライバーの交代方法を決める •
時間で区切る?機能単位?他の何か? • リモートチーム用タイマー https://cuckoo.team/next-ccmob • ナビゲーターが議論し,ドライバーがコードを書く • ドライバーの交代時間になったらコードをcommit & push • 適度に休憩時間を設ける
9.
ドライバーの技術 • 自分の考えだけでコーディングを進めない • ナビゲーターが静かに見守るだけ,になりがち •
ナビゲーターからの案を素直に実装するのが基本 • もちろん,よりよいアイデアがあれば議論に参加しよう • 自分の思考を垂れ流す(しゃべる) • どんなコードを書こうと思っているかを垂れ流す • 分からないことがあれば,分からないことを伝える • 難易度が高い技術なので練習しよう
10.
モブプロQ&A • 個々人で分散開発した方が効率良いのでは? • 時と場合に依るとは思います •
複雑な作業はモブプロが適すると感じます • 皆の英知を集めて作業できること,皆が知識を得られることが大きい • 事実,サイボウズの開発は大部分がモブプロになりました • その他質問ありますか
Download